Output 6e89cea65e73b1f7abc24a32dbd00ea0ddf90a893767d01f3b2f934462bbe2c9:4

value
43329000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 014feabaa8ea36a219458e3e4aa691f44d274498 OP_EQUAL
address
31oxLTdJsLZLAt7wP5wuyfSJTyWgM9kRYa
transaction
6e89cea65e73b1f7abc24a32dbd00ea0ddf90a893767d01f3b2f934462bbe2c9